Form 4: Entergy CEO Sells Shares for Tax Obligations
Insider Trading Report
Entergy's Chair and CEO, Andrew S. Marsh, disposed of 4,403 shares of common stock at $93.19 per share to satisfy tax withholding obligations.
Summary
- Andrew S. Marsh, the Chair and CEO of Entergy Corp /DE/ (ETR), reported a transaction involving the company's common stock.
- On January 25, 2026, Marsh disposed of 4,403 shares of Entergy common stock.
- The shares were disposed of at a price of $93.19 per share.
- The transaction code 'F' indicates that the disposition was made to the issuer to satisfy tax withholding obligations.
- Following this transaction, Andrew S. Marsh directly beneficially owns 436,268 shares of common stock.
- Additionally, Marsh indirectly beneficially owns 2,382 shares through a 401(k) plan.
